Can I make this poke cake ahead of time?
Yes, assemble the cake up to 2 days ahead. Cover t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ate. Add the whipped topping, apples, and chopped Snickers no more than 4 hours before serving to prevent sogginess.
Why do you poke holes in the cake?
Poking holes allows the Snickers pudding mixture and caramel to soak into the cake layers, infusing it with flavor and moisture throughout rather than just on top.
Can I substitute the green apples?
Yes, use Granny Smith for tartness, or swap for diced Honeycrisp, Fuji, or red apples. Toss any apple variety with lemon juice to prevent browning.
What if I don't have Snickers instant pudding?
Use vanilla pudding mix and stir in 2 tablespoons of peanut butter mixed with caramel sauce for a similar Snickers-inspired flavor.
How should I store leftover poke cake?
Cover and refrigerate for up to 3 days. The cake is best served chilled and does not freeze well due to the whipped topping texture.
